Who narrates Frontline Fightback?

Rav Wilding’s powerful narration of Frontline Fightback makes the documentary series come to life. Rav guides the audience through the documentary series with his unique voice and captivating narration, expertly establishing a connection between the audience and the moving stories and real-life heroes that are showcased.

Series 2, Episode 1

In Frontline Fightback BBC One season 2, a horrifying early-evening heist in a calm residential neighborhood ends with young mother Courtney Slater being pulled screaming from her car at knifepoint.

Series 2, Episode 2

After a demanding 12-hour shift, a nurse in the emergency room of Barnsley Hospital arrives home to find her home has been broken into. As her neighbors come together, two nearby businesses offer to install an alarm system and motion-detecting equipment in her house.

Series 2, Episode 3

Hull police investigators go to considerable measures to compile a digital trail of evidence that points to two motorcycle-mounted robbers who targeted an 85-year-old woman as she was leaving the church.

Series 2, Episode 4

Police are assisted in identifying two wanted thieves by an amazing digital evidence dossier compiled by a neighborhood watch organization. Such organizations, according to criminologist Dr. Emmeline Taylor, can be an essential weapon in the war against crime.

Series 2, Episode 5

Dashcams are installed in millions of vehicles, and the video they record is being utilized more frequently as proof in instances of reckless driving, such as the horrifying head-on collision between two vehicles in the Cotswold village of Lechlade

Series 2, Episode 6

In Ely, Cambridgeshire, a group wearing masks breaks into and loots an Italian jeweler’s store. But offenders like these can no longer be certain of avoiding prosecution, according to the most recent advancements in face recognition software.

Series 2, Episode 7

Thousands of repeat criminals, such as robbers, thieves, and burglars, are being equipped with electronic GPS tags, and their activities are frequently tracked around the clock. According to Suzanne Bennett, the probation officer, nobody who has worn one of these tags has committed another crime.

Series 2, Episode 8

Electronic GPS tags are being fitted to thousands of recurrent offenders, including thieves, burglars, and robbers, and their movements are regularly monitored round-the-clock. Nobody who has worn one of these tags has, in the probation officer Suzanne Bennett’s opinion, committed another crime.

Series 2, Episode 9

Investigators try to learn the truth about a large-scale gas explosion by using digital and forensic search tools. When her son’s motorcycle is taken in broad daylight from a parking lot, a mother uses social media to make an assistance request.

Series 2, Episode 10

The man who flung acid in his ex-girlfriend’s face and then changed identities to evade capture was apprehended with the use of number plate recognition cameras. A covert tracking gadget aids in the recovery of a pilfered Land Rover.

Series 3, Episode 1

Three masked males approach a couple who are attempting to steal a catalytic converter from beneath the vehicle that is parked in their driveway. They use their smartphone to record the event. Cumbrian police canines are also outfitted with sophisticated cameras.

Series 3, Episode 2

An examination of the methods used by artificial intelligence-equipped cameras to identify truck drivers who are using their phones while driving. Additionally, how police use night-vision equipment to combat offenders who prey on remote rural places

Series 3, Episode 3

When two of a family’s dogs are taken from the garden, the family is devastated. To aid in the reunion of canines and their proper owners, a distinctive DNA database has just been established. How detailed 3D crime scenes are being created by CSIs with the use of laser scanning.

Series 3, Episode 4

Online hackers are threatening a young couple’s new camping venture. a look at the methods being used by the West Midlands Cyber Crime Unit to counter this expanding cyber threat. Also, how clever trackers aid in the recovery of stolen vehicles with fictitious license plates.

Series 3, Episode 5

When a brick is thrown at the train driver’s cab, it injures his face. Today, safety is ensured by on-board equipment that examines the track and embankments. How victims of stalking and domestic violence are benefiting from forensic marking spray.

Series 3, Episode 6

Carjackers attack a motorist in Birmingham outside of his own residence. The mobile laboratory for forensics that applies science to criminal scenes. A look at the efforts being made to lessen knife violence by a father whose son was fatally stabbed is also included.

Series 3, Episode 7

One mother is slain by a reckless motorist. A look at how antisocial drivers are being targeted by noise-detecting cameras. Additionally discussed are the value of fingerprint evidence and the ways that 3D graphics present criminal scenes in court.

Series 3, Episode 8

A biker retaliates against thefts of bicycles. An examination of a novel DNA method that aids forensic illustrators in creating criminal portraits. A mechanic for cars had his vehicle broken into and his tools pilfered, but neighbors helped him out.

Series 3, Episode 9

A family-owned farm is plagued by break-ins and thefts. However, companies located in rural places are now better protected by innovative security systems that do not require a strong internet connection. How mobile phone towers aided in the prosecution of thieves.

Series 3, Episode 10

Following a ram raid on a jeweler’s shop in Leeds, a car forensics specialist assists in assembling the case by retrieving critical data from a vehicle’s infotainment system. Birmingham drugstore confronts shoplifters head-on.
